Two good suggestions

I love Scratch! I love making video games! But I have more ideas, and I got two good suggestions you should all agree to.

1. Increasing the file size limit
Agent Blueberry is my best adventure game I've ever made. But I can't post it up on Scratch anymore, because the game has become too big and advanced for the Scratch website. I wanted to show my games to everyone so badly! Is it possible to increase the file size limit?

2. making Layers a variable
I have looked for numerous ways of making a 3D game in Scratch. I tried creating a 3D model from animation master, but the gameplay is still flat. I also tried using both the layers and size commands to make a z-axis for Agent Blueberry, but everything is too glitchy. Making a 2D game look 3D would be a lot easier if you were to just make Layers a variable. Please!

1. The 10 megabyte limit is due to restrictions with Java (for the Java Player) - but in Scratch 2.0 the limit might go up, since it'll be using Flash for the online viewer.  smile
